King Fahad's Fountain, Water jet fountain on Corniche coast, Saudi Arabia.

King Fahad's Fountain is a massive water jet on Jeddah's coast that shoots seawater high into the air, creating a dramatic visual feature along the harbor landscape. The engineering is hidden beneath the water surface, with the visible spray as the main element that catches the eye from land.

The fountain was built during the 1980s and reflects Saudi Arabia's modernization efforts of that era. It quickly became a known landmark for the city and has remained a major part of Jeddah's waterfront identity since its completion.

The fountain serves as a defining symbol for Jeddah residents, representing both the city's connection to the sea and its prosperity. It draws people together along the waterfront, becoming a focal point where locals and visitors share the experience of watching the water dance against the sky.

The best time to watch is in the late afternoon when the light highlights the water jets and the sun sits lower in the sky. The Corniche waterfront path offers several spots where you can get a clear view of the display from shore.

The system draws from the sea itself and sprays with tremendous force, making it a remarkable feat of engineering. This blend of natural seawater and raw mechanical power is what makes the experience feel so charged with energy when you watch it.
